The SMP80MC-320 from STMicroelectronics is a state-of-the-art Transil™ diode designed to provide robust protection for sensitive electronics. This transient voltage suppressor (TVS) diode is specifically engineered to shield circuits against voltage transients induced by system inductance, load dump, and other abrupt voltage changes that can occur in industrial, automotive, and consumer applications.
Key Features
- Peak Pulse Power: The SMP80MC-320 can handle 600W (10/1000 μs) and 400W (8/20 μs) peak pulse power, ensuring effective protection against high energy transients.
- Stand-off Voltage: With a stand-off voltage of 320V, it is well-suited for a wide range of applications that require a higher voltage rating.
- Low Clamping Voltage: The device offers a low clamping voltage relative to its stand-off voltage, which helps to minimize the stress on the protected component during a transient event.
- Fast Response Time: Its fast response time ensures quick protection for sensitive circuits from the very first moment a transient occurs.
- Low Leakage Current: The low leakage current of the SMP80MC-320 helps to maintain energy efficiency in the systems it protects.
- Package: Available in a surface-mount SMB (DO-214AA) package, it allows for efficient assembly and space-saving design in printed circuit boards.
